Ingredients
- 2 packages 6.2oz packages rice-a-roni fried rice
- I package 16oz frozen stir fry vegetables
- 1 stick butter
- 2 cups chicken broth, low sodium
- 4 cups pork lion, sliced thin
- - green onion
- - mushroom pieces, optional i love shrooms
How To Make pork fried rice, iris
-
Step 1Cook rice according to package directions, I replaced 2 cups of the 4 cups of water with chicken broth for additional flavor.
-
Step 2When rice liquid is almost all absorbed, stir in stir fry veggies ( thawed, but still cold, so they don't lose their color).
-
Step 3pork loin with an electric knife then add the mushrooms, cover and let sit for 15 minutes before serving, top with slice green onions.
